ABOUT
We believe that inclusive design leads to better design for everyone. We wanted to revolutionize deodorant design to include everyone, however they are able to move. By co-creating the product with the disabled community themselves, we have designed a deodorant that’s easier to handle, easier to identify, easier to open and close, easier to apply. In fact, it can be opened and used with your mouth and feet if, you are unable to use your arms or hands. Our team was international, diverse and multi-disciplinary, including a disabled inclusive designer, engineer, occupational therapist, psychologist and members of the disabled community. Innovative design elements include: -MAGNETIC CAP for easier opening and closing for users with limited muscle strength and allowing for auditory confirmation for visually impaired users. -LARGER ROLLERBALL to cover more surface area in one swipe as additional movement is difficult for people with disabilities. Also eliminates risk of hair being tangled on the rollerball. -HOOK design for easier handling (the hook can be hung for opening with one hand). -EMBOSSED LOGO for the visually impaired. -Bottom GRIP that requires limited to no finger movement. To ensure the prototype is effective and fully accessible, Degree has created a beta program to engage the disability community to trial the design and give their feedback on its concept, product features, and messaging, helping to improve the design for the full global consumer launch.
